Source Code

binder/header_test.go lines 10–50

func Test_HeaderBinder_Bind(t *testing.T) {
	t.Parallel()

	b := &HeaderBinding{
		EnableSplitting: true,
	}
	require.Equal(t, "header", b.Name())

	type User struct {
		Name  string   `header:"Name"`
		Names []string `header:"Names"`
		Posts []string `header:"Posts"`
		Age   int      `header:"Age"`
	}
	var user User

	req := fasthttp.AcquireRequest()
	req.Header.Set("name", "john")
	req.Header.Set("names", "john,doe")
	req.Header.Set("age", "42")
	req.Header.Set("posts", "post1,post2,post3")

	t.Cleanup(func() {
		fasthttp.ReleaseRequest(req)
	})

	err := b.Bind(req, &user)

	require.NoError(t, err)
	require.Equal(t, "john", user.Name)
	require.Equal(t, 42, user.Age)
	require.Len(t, user.Posts, 3)
	require.Equal(t, "post1", user.Posts[0])
	require.Equal(t, "post2", user.Posts[1])
	require.Equal(t, "post3", user.Posts[2])
	require.Contains(t, user.Names, "john")
	require.Contains(t, user.Names, "doe")

	b.Reset()
	require.False(t, b.EnableSplitting)
}
